Output 70d08981db01dacaa9ed77bf7ea710fa3e889360c048e9bcb89ebec78ef2ee38:1

value
15242305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c444614ed1f57a45667091bf82419b79fb5d1b9 OP_EQUAL
address
35j5SjBWZy4hekdanTQP2W8Vf3Hz5PAmBc
transaction
70d08981db01dacaa9ed77bf7ea710fa3e889360c048e9bcb89ebec78ef2ee38
confirmations
281713
spent
true